Pitch Summary:
Hudbay Minerals (Long +46%) shares rose over the quarter as copper prices moved higher (+2%), most notably in September with Freeport’s Grasberg mine suspending production following a mudslide. With 3% of global copper supply offline, disruptions compounded other production issues worldwide. Pitch Summary:
EPAM underperformed due to sector weakness in IT services and AI-driven disruption. The fund continues to hold the position, citing business quality but limited near-term visibility.

BSD Analysis:
While fundamentals remain strong, AI automation pressures have compressed growth and margins. Trading at ~18x forward EPS, EPAM offers long-term optionality if digital transformation spending reaccelerates, but execution risk persists.

Pitch Summary:
Dexcom posted its third consecutive quarter of accelerating growth, raising FY25 guidance despite sector volatility. Shares sold off on cautious commentary but fundamentals remain robust.

BSD Analysis:
Sands Capital views Dexcom’s leadership in glucose monitoring as intact. The new 15-day sensor, Medicare expansion, and operational leverage set the stage for meaningful margin recovery through 2026.

Pitch Summary:
Netflix raised full-year revenue and margin guidance, reflecting strong subscriber growth and advertising performance. Shares corrected after a strong first half but fundamentals remain intact.

BSD Analysis:
Sands Capital expects continued leadership in streaming supported by engagement, pricing power, and ad monetization. With 30%+ operating margins and rising FCF, Netflix remains the benchmark for global digital media scale.
